Yard signs are a ubiquitous and effective tool for conveying messages quickly and concisely. They serve as silent announcers, guiding visitors to events, advertising products or services, or making political statements.
The effectiveness of yard signs lies in their size, positioning, and message. This blog post will explore standard yard sign sizes and their uses. Read on to learn the details.
Yard sign sizes vary, each with unique advantages and suitable applications. Let's explore some of the most common dimensions:
Yard sign sizes significantly impact their use. More prominent signs, like the 18x24 or 12x24, are perfect for commercial purposes or high-traffic areas. Their size allows for larger text and more complex graphics, which can be seen from a distance.
On the other hand, smaller signs like the 12x18 or 9x12 are ideal for personal events or smaller-scale advertising. These signs can convey messages effectively without overwhelming the space or the viewer.
Selecting the right size for your yard sign depends on several factors. Consider the distance from which it will be viewed - larger signs are more effective for long-distance visibility. Also, think about the complexity of your message. A larger sign may be necessary if you have more text or intricate graphics.
Remember, the goal of a yard sign is to communicate a message quickly and effectively. Therefore, ensure the text is large enough to read from the intended viewing distance and that any graphics are clear and understandable.
Yard signs are a powerful communication tool, but their effectiveness relies heavily on choosing the right size. Remember, the purpose of your sign, its location, and the complexity of your message should guide your decision. With the correct size, your yard sign can grab attention, convey your message, and make a lasting impression.
